It is necessary to review your coverage commonly to guarantee you have enough to safeguard enduring relative. The main recipient gets 100% of the survivor benefit when the insured dies. If the main beneficiary passes prior to the insured, the contingent obtains the advantage. Tertiary beneficiaries are frequently a last hope and are just made use of when the main and contingent beneficiaries pass prior to the guaranteed.

It is necessary to periodically evaluate your beneficiary information to make certain it's updated. Last cost insurance is a little entire life insurance policy that is simple to receive. The beneficiaries of a last expense life insurance policy plan can use the plan's payment to spend for a funeral service, coffin or cremation, clinical bills, nursing home bills, an obituary, blossoms, and more. However, the fatality advantage can be utilized for any type of purpose whatsoever.

When you use for final cost insurance, you will certainly not need to take care of a medical test or let the insurance provider accessibility your medical documents. Nevertheless, you will certainly have to address some health questions. Due to the wellness questions, not everybody will certainly qualify for a policy with insurance coverage that begins on day one.

Best Burial Life Insurance Companies

The older and much less healthy and balanced you are, the higher your rates will be for an offered amount of insurance policy. Men have a tendency to pay higher prices than ladies since of their shorter average life span. And, relying on the insurance provider, you may qualify for a lower rate if you do not use tobacco.

Depending on the policy and the insurance company, there may be a minimum age (such as 45) and optimum age (such as 85) at which you can apply. The biggest survivor benefit you can pick might be smaller sized the older you are. Plans may rise to $50,000 as long as you're more youthful than 55 yet just go up to $25,000 once you turn 76.
